From 1e7b116842ea0e0ad76a70e2736398ef2211dde9 Mon Sep 17 00:00:00 2001 From: Prashanth Mundkur Date: Tue, 23 Oct 2018 15:17:22 -0700 Subject: RISC-V: use stderr for terminal output in OCaml backend. Also add a brief README for booting Linux on the C and OCaml backends. --- riscv/platform_impl.ml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'riscv/platform_impl.ml') diff --git a/riscv/platform_impl.ml b/riscv/platform_impl.ml index e593dce9..c5cc3fff 100644 --- a/riscv/platform_impl.ml +++ b/riscv/platform_impl.ml @@ -159,7 +159,7 @@ let make_dtb dts = (* Call the dtc compiler, assumed to be at /usr/bin/dtc *) (* Terminal I/O *) let term_write char = - ignore (Unix.write_substring Unix.stdout (String.make 1 char) 0 1) + ignore (Unix.write_substring Unix.stderr (String.make 1 char) 0 1) let rec term_read () = let buf = Bytes.make 1 '\000' in -- cgit v1.2.3